Alright, let’s talk about makin’ a frozen peanut butter pie, but hold on, we ain’t usin’ none of that fancy cream cheese stuff. You know, the kind them city folks like. This here’s a pie for real people, the kind that likes things simple and tasty.

First off, you gotta get yourself a good crust. Now, you can buy one of them ready-made ones at the store, that’s what I usually do, saves a whole lotta fussin’. Or, if you’re feelin’ ambitious, you can make your own with crushed up cookies and some butter. But honestly, who’s got time for that? I ain’t got all day, got chickens to feed and whatnot.

  • Ready-made crust or homemade crushed cookie crust
  • Peanut butter, creamy or crunchy, your pick!
  • Sweetened condensed milk, the thick, sweet stuff
  • Some milk, just regular milk, nothin’ fancy
  • Vanilla extract, if you got it, adds a little somethin’ somethin’
  • Whipped cream or cool whip, for the top, if you’re feelin’ fancy

Okay, so you got your crust all ready in your pie plate. Now, the easy part. Dump a whole jar of peanut butter in a bowl. Yep, the whole thing. I told you this was easy. I like to use the creamy kind, but my grandson, he likes the crunchy. So, you do what you like. It’s your pie, ain’t it?

Next, pour in that can of sweetened condensed milk. You know, the stuff that’s thick and sticky like molasses? That’s the stuff. Mix it all together with the peanut butter. Stir it good, real good, till it’s all smooth and creamy. If it’s too thick, add a little bit of milk, just a splash at a time, till it looks right. And if you have some vanilla layin’ around, pour in a little splash too. It’ll make it taste all the better.

Now, pour that peanut buttery goodness into your pie crust. Spread it out nice and even. Then, cover it up with some plastic wrap, or foil, whatever you got. Stick it in the freezer. Yep, the freezer. Not the fridge, the freezer. We’re makin’ a frozen pie, remember?

Leave it in there for a good long while. At least four hours, but I like to leave it overnight. That way, it’s good and frozen solid. When you’re ready to eat it, take it out of the freezer and let it sit for a bit, maybe 10 or 15 minutes, just so it ain’t rock hard. You want it to be firm, but you still want to be able to cut it.

Now, if you wanna get all fancy, you can put some whipped cream or Cool Whip on top. My granddaughter likes when I add some chocolate shavings on top too. Now, you might be wonderin’ how long this pie will keep in the freezer. Well, I can tell you, it don’t last long in my house. But if you manage to not eat it all in one sittin’, it’ll keep in the freezer for a good couple of weeks. Just make sure it’s wrapped up tight, so it don’t get all freezer-burned.
